The Necessity of Authentic Emotion

The narrative posits that enforced happiness, devoid of authentic emotional range, is an unsustainable and dehumanizing paradigm. Through the Doctor’s strategic manipulation, Earl Sigma’s harmonica, and the symbolic repainting of the TARDIS, the story establishes that genuine sorrow, joy, and defiance are not merely optional human traits but essential components of societal resilience. Susan’s transformation from blind enforcer to expressive rebel exemplifies this transition, while Daisy K’s collapse under interrogation reveals the psychological cost of suppressing truth. The theme is underscored by the contrast between forced performances (Muzak, synthetic syrup) and the raw emotional expression that catalyzes rebellion—culminating in Earl’s deliberate choice to stay and reintroduce the blues to a numbed society.
